
Donna Douglas, best known for playing Elly May Clampett on The Beverly Hillbillies, died Friday morning, according to NBC 12. She was 81.
Douglas, who most recently made her way into the press for her 2011 lawsuit against Mattel Inc. claiming they used her likeness for a Barbie doll without authorization, was also known for starring alongside Elvis Presley in 1966’s Frankie and Johnny. She appeared on a number of television shows, from Mister Ed to 77 Sunset Strip.
Douglas’ cause of death has not yet been released.
